Job Description

We are looking for an experienced HR Manager to build and strengthen the HR function for a manufacturing unit. The role will focus on HR team development, process standardization, system optimization, workforce planning, and creating scalable HR practices aligned with factory operations.

Job Responsibility

  • Build, lead, and develop the factory HR team and define clear roles, KRAs, and accountability.
  • Design and implement standardized HR policies, SOPs, and operational processes.
  • Improve HR systems, documentation, reporting, and workflow efficiency.
  • Drive HR digitalization, HRMS implementation, attendance/payroll integration, and process automation.
  • Develop structured recruitment, onboarding, training, and performance management systems.
  • Create employee engagement and retention initiatives for factory workforce.
  • Ensure statutory compliance related to labor laws, PF, ESI, Factory Act, and audits.
  • Strengthen manpower planning, succession planning, and organizational structure.
  • Coordinate with plant leadership to improve productivity, discipline, and workforce stability.
  • Establish data-driven HR reporting and MIS dashboards.

Requirements

  • Experience: 7-15 Years
  • Qualification: MBA HR / MSW / PGDM HR
  • Strong experience in manufacturing/factory HR operations
  • Expertise in HR process improvement and system implementation
  • Experience in team building and organizational development.
  • Strong knowledge of labor laws and compliance
  • Excellent le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ills
  • Hands-on experience with HRMS, payroll systems, and HR analytics

Nice to have

  • Experience in scaling HR functions in growing manufacturing organizations
  • Exposure to process excellence, SOP creation, or HR transformation projects
  • Ability to drive change management and operational efficiency
